29.41.5 port vdsl frequencyplan Command
Syntax:
port vdsl frequencyplan <slot-port> <997|998>
where
This command sets the band plan the VDSL port(s) uses.
The following example shows the configuration of port 5 on the VDSL card in slot 4 for an
asymmetric connection.

xtuc =
Set parameters for downstream transmissions.
xtur =
Set parameters for upstream transmissions.
etrmax,
etrmin
=
The minimum and maximum effective (allowed) throughput rates, 0~100032 in
kbps.
ndrmax =
The maximum net data rate in kbps, 0~100032 in kbps.
shinerat
io
=
A Single High Impulse Noise Event (SHINE) is non-periodical (random) electrical
noise encountered on DSL lines. They are usually large pulses that have a short
duration. Specify the assumed fraction of NDR to correct SHINE noise. 0~100 in
units of 0.001.
leftrthr
eshold
=
Specify the threshold for declaring a Low Error-Free Troughput Rate defect. This is a
percent of the net data rate. 0~99 in units of 0.01.
maxdelay =
Specify the maximum number of milliseconds (0~63) of retransmission delays. It is
recommended that you configure the same delays for both upstream and
downstream.
